Richard Nixon, grand marshal of the Rose Bowl: "As Vice-president I'm neutral. But as a Californian I'm for the West."
Preston Carpenter, professional football player for the Cleveland Browns, after learning he'd been traded: "I was going to leave anyway. I just wasn't having fun."
Paul Richards, Baltimore Oriole manager, on Branch Rickey and his struggling Continental League: "He's the kind of guy who goes in the revolving door behind you and comes out ahead of you."
James Hoffa, hearing that Fight Manager Doc Kearns thinks professional athletes need a union: "I'm all for it. We'll go right down the line."
